Output 626ab27cff67d5763cbb24aacd775ef187677541e0f685173c58a802734fd901:0

value
19990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65d2fd76bb94079aa8d322afee7b2f5556827625 OP_EQUALVERIFY OP_CHECKSIG
address
1AHQ1DxybMg1B13jxxJzajqWbT5j27UVjS
transaction
626ab27cff67d5763cbb24aacd775ef187677541e0f685173c58a802734fd901
spent
true